Abstract

Methods and system for managing inventory in the context of online transactions involving blockchain-based payments. Examples may include determine an inventory count associated with an item with which a user device initiates a payment involving a blockchain transaction. The system determines a likelihood of completion with regard to the blockchain transaction based on one or more metrics related to recent transactions on the blockchain. Responsive to the likelihood of completion being above a minimum threshold value, the system records a hold in memory in association with the inventory count and then determines that the blockchain transaction has been completed and, in response, removes the hold from memory and decrements the inventory count.
